What Are Wallet Tracker Card

Wallet tracker cards are specialized electronic devices designed to help you locate your wallet or other valuable items when they're misplaced or lost. These ultra-thin tracking devices are shaped like credit cards, allowing them to fit seamlessly inside wallets without adding bulk or requiring additional accessories.

Unlike traditional item trackers that attach externally with keyrings or adhesives, wallet tracker cards slip directly into a card slot, becoming virtually invisible during everyday use. They connect to your smartphone via Bluetooth and leverage tracking networks to help you pinpoint their location.

Modern wallet trackers typically work through companion apps or integration with existing ecosystems like Apple's Find My network. When your wallet is nearby but out of sight, you can trigger an audible alert from the card. If your wallet is truly lost or left behind, GPS and crowd-sourced location data can show its last known position on a map.

Advanced models offer features like separation alerts (notifying you when you leave your wallet behind), two-way finding (using the card to locate your phone), and water resistance. Battery solutions vary from replaceable coin cells to rechargeable batteries with wireless charging capability.

These devices represent a significant evolution from traditional tracking solutions, offering specialized design and functionality specifically optimized for wallet protection and recovery.

What to Look for When Choosing Wallet Tracker Card

  • Compatibility With Your Phone: Ensure the tracker works with your specific smartphone model and operating system, as many premium options are iOS exclusive.
  • Battery Life and Charging Method: Consider how long the battery lasts and how it recharges – options range from solar power to wireless charging to replaceable batteries.
  • Card Thickness: Check the tracker's dimensions, as thicker cards may displace other cards in slim wallets or create uncomfortable bulging in your pocket.
  • Tracking Network Coverage: Evaluate whether the tracker uses a proprietary network or integrates with established systems like Apple's Find My network for wider coverage.
  • Alert Volume: Ensure the tracker's sound is loud enough to hear in various environments, with stronger alerts (90+dB) being essential for noisy locations.
  • Water Resistance Rating: Look for appropriate IP ratings (IP67 or IP68) if you need protection against accidental water exposure or regularly use your wallet in outdoor settings.
  • Additional Smart Features: Consider special functions like separation alerts, voice assistant integration, or camera remote control that might enhance the tracker's utility.

What to Avoid When Choosing Wallet Tracker Card

  • Ignoring Compatibility Requirements: Many premium trackers work exclusively with iOS or Android. Purchasing a tracker incompatible with your phone renders it completely useless.
  • Overlooking Battery Limitations: Some trackers have non-replaceable batteries with finite lifespans, potentially requiring complete replacement after 1-2 years of use.
  • Assuming Universal Tracking Coverage: Trackers rely on Bluetooth networks or specific ecosystems. Rural areas or regions with fewer users may have significantly reduced tracking effectiveness.
  • Choosing Based on Price Alone: The cheapest options often lack critical features like separation alerts or water resistance, potentially costing more in the long run if they fail to prevent loss.
  • Neglecting Physical Dimensions: Trackers that are too thick can damage your wallet, displace other cards, or create uncomfortable bulging that discourages regular carrying.
